Understanding the Role of a Judicial Services Development and Government Affairs Manager

A Judicial Services Development and Government Affairs Manager is responsible for managing relationships between judicial institutions and government bodies. Their primary objective is to support legal development programs, improve public services, and ensure that organizational goals align with government regulations and policies.

These professionals often act as a bridge between legal authorities, public agencies, and private organizations. They monitor legislative developments, coordinate government relations, and provide strategic guidance on legal and policy matters. Their work helps organizations stay informed about regulatory changes and maintain positive relationships with government officials.

Key Responsibilities of a Judicial Services Development and Government Affairs Manager

The responsibilities of a Judicial Services Development and Government Affairs Manager are diverse and require a combination of legal knowledge, communication skills, and strategic thinking. One of their main duties is to develop and maintain relationships with government representatives, judicial officials, and regulatory authorities.

They also monitor legal and policy developments that may impact organizational operations. By analyzing new laws and regulations, they help management teams make informed decisions. Another important responsibility is coordinating projects that aim to improve judicial services and public administration.

These managers often prepare reports, policy recommendations, and presentations for senior leadership. They may also represent their organization during meetings with government agencies, legal institutions, and public stakeholders. Their involvement ensures smooth communication and successful collaboration among all parties.

Essential Skills Required for Success

To succeed as a Judicial Services Development and Government Affairs Manager, professionals need a broad range of skills. Strong communication abilities are among the most important requirements. Since the role involves interacting with government officials, legal professionals, and organizational leaders, clear and effective communication is essential.

Analytical thinking is another critical skill. Managers must evaluate legal documents, policy proposals, and regulatory developments to understand their potential impact. Problem-solving abilities help them address complex challenges and develop practical solutions.

Leadership skills are equally important because these professionals often coordinate teams, manage projects, and oversee strategic initiatives. Negotiation and relationship-building abilities also contribute significantly to success in this position.

Educational Background and Professional Qualifications

Most Judicial Services Development and Government Affairs Managers have educational backgrounds in law, public administration, political science, business administration, or related fields. A strong understanding of legal systems and government operations provides a solid foundation for this career.

Many employers prefer candidates with advanced degrees or specialized certifications in public policy, government relations, or legal management. Professional experience in legal services, government agencies, regulatory affairs, or public administration is also highly valued.

Continuous learning is important because laws, regulations, and government policies frequently change. Staying updated with industry developments helps professionals maintain their effectiveness and credibility.

Challenges Faced in the Role

The role of a Judicial Services Development and Government Affairs Manager comes with several challenges. One common challenge is navigating complex regulatory environments. Laws and policies can vary across regions and may change frequently, requiring constant monitoring and adaptation.

Balancing the interests of different stakeholders can also be difficult. Government agencies, judicial institutions, and organizational leaders may have different priorities and expectations. Managers must find solutions that support collaboration while maintaining compliance and ethical standards.

Another challenge involves managing public expectations. Judicial reforms and government initiatives often attract significant public attention. Professionals in this role must communicate clearly and support transparency throughout the implementation process.

Career Opportunities and Growth Potential

The demand for Judicial Services Development and Government Affairs Managers is growing as governments and organizations focus on regulatory compliance, legal reform, and public service improvement. Career opportunities are available in government departments, legal institutions, multinational corporations, nonprofit organizations, and consulting firms.

Professionals with strong experience may advance to senior leadership positions such as Director of Government Affairs, Head of Public Policy, Legal Affairs Director, or Chief Compliance Officer. These leadership roles offer greater responsibilities and opportunities to influence organizational strategy.

The increasing complexity of legal and regulatory environments means that skilled professionals will continue to be valuable assets across multiple sectors. This creates strong long-term career prospects and opportunities for professional development.
